7 Signs Your Business Needs a Custom Laravel Application Instead of Off-the-Shelf Software

 

Introduction

Off-the-shelf software works well—until it doesn't.

As businesses grow, many discover that generic software forces them to change their processes instead of supporting them.

Here are seven signs it's time to invest in a custom Laravel application.


1. Your Team Uses Multiple Disconnected Systems

If employees constantly switch between:

  • CRM
  • ERP
  • Accounting software
  • Excel spreadsheets
  • Email
  • Project management tools

you're likely losing productivity.

A custom Laravel application can integrate these systems into a unified workflow.


2. Manual Processes Consume Too Much Time

Manual data entry often leads to:

  • Human errors
  • Delays
  • Duplicate work
  • Higher operational costs

Automation through Laravel workflows can eliminate repetitive tasks.


3. Your Software Doesn't Match Your Business Process

Every business has unique workflows.

If your current software requires workarounds or compromises, custom development often provides a better long-term solution.


4. Performance Has Become an Issue

Growing businesses frequently experience:

  • Slow reports
  • Database bottlenecks
  • Long loading times
  • Poor user experience

Laravel offers robust performance optimization techniques that support high-growth applications.


5. Integration Has Become Difficult

Modern businesses rely on numerous services.

Examples include:

  • Stripe
  • Xero
  • Zoho
  • AWS
  • Twilio
  • Payment gateways
  • Shipping providers

Laravel simplifies third-party integrations through APIs and well-supported packages.


6. Security and Compliance Matter

Industries such as:

  • Healthcare
  • Finance
  • Manufacturing
  • Legal

often require stronger security controls.

Laravel includes built-in security features that support secure application development when implemented correctly.


7. You're Planning Long-Term Growth

If your roadmap includes:

  • Mobile applications
  • Customer portals
  • Partner dashboards
  • Multi-location operations
  • SaaS products

a scalable custom platform becomes a strategic investment rather than an expense.


Choosing the Right Development Partner

Technology alone doesn't guarantee project success.

Look for a development partner that offers:

  • Business analysis
  • Architecture planning
  • Agile development
  • API expertise
  • Ongoing maintenance
  • Transparent communication

These factors often make a greater difference than the framework itself.


Conclusion

Custom Laravel development isn't necessary for every business.

But when your operations outgrow generic software, investing in a tailored solution can improve productivity, reduce operational costs, and provide a platform that grows with your business.
